Online listing for America Mufflers (Automotive Exhaust System Repair) located in 901 N 7th St, Phoenix, AZ, 85006, Maricopa county. If you have questions or want to know prices, offers, discounts for automotive repair in Phoenix, AZ, feel free to contact Carlos Lopez at (602) 253-4274 or visit America Mufflers office.
Business Name
America Mufflers
Category
Automotive Exhaust System Repair
Address
901 N 7th St, Phoenix, 85006, AZ,